    Stephen I.

    This restaurant was a culinary experience that rivals the best restaurants in the world. It combines the artistic plating of Osteria Francescana with the warmth in service and taste of Eleven Madison Park, and the panoramic (180 degree) view of Rome from the top of the Spanish Steps makes it worth it in and of itself. The tasting menu is definitely the way to go--I think the 8 course is sufficient. The staff was friendly and extremely accommodating with switching out certain dishes in the tasting menu due to allergies. The sweet bufala mozzarella and beet granita (the dessert course of the 8 course tasting) was sublime.

    Brett W.

    One of the most opulent settings in which I've ever dined, with breathtaking views of the Eternal City. Also, the service here is better than any I can recall. The waiters look they were recruited from the ranks of a military academy. And they wore tail coats, for heaven's sake! As superb as all this was, the food was just as magnificent. We were offered salmon-wrapped ricotta and a trio of amuse-bouches to begin, followed by a crudo of john dory. I had fried stuffed scallops, which weren't as wonderful as the other dishes we had but still very good. Next came a fusilloni carbonara with quail ragu and quail eggs, quite possibly the most deliciously decadent pasta dish I've ever eaten in my 37 years on this earth. Wakako U. had a filet steak with curry shrimp, the latter of which she didn't enjoy but I liked just fine. I had breaded mackerel over what I believe were pureed fava beans. After that heavenly pasta, how could it measure up? We washed all of this deliciousness down with an '07 Trappolini Paterno Sangiovese. This culinary adventure set us back a cool 281 euros ($387), and that's without tip, but it was well worth it! Oh, and in case it matters to you, they've got a Michelin star. In summary: Perfect view. Perfect service. Excellent food (with perfect carbonara!). Perfect wine. Go. Now.

    One of the most popular Italian restaurants in Rome with multiple locations throughout the city all…read morewith lines. When we arrived on a late afternoon, we waited about 10 minutes before getting seated. To start off, we got the Limoncello Spritz (€10) and Aperol Spritz (€10), which were refreshing. For our pasta, we ordered the Fettuccine with Oxtail (€18) and Carbonara (€17). We also wanted to order two more Secondi dishes, but the waiter warned us that the pasta is filling. After we finished the pasta, we did still order the Rabbit (€19) because it wasn't something we usually see on the menu. For the carbonara, the flavor was delicious but not really my favorite pasta shape. It was also quite al dente with a chewy texture. I have to say that the oxtail was spectacular though with its juicy and tender meat sauce. While the rabbit was nice to try once, it was a bit dry with minimal meat. Overall, good spot but nothing worth waiting too long for. Also, I'd stick to the pasta here as it's all handmade. You even see them handrolling them inside. Note that they also charge €2 per person for service fee already.
